| Team Diva (website) is a all Women's Synchronized Ski Team. We are from the Aspen Ski and Snowboard Schools in Colorado. Click on Photos to enlarge Divas on top of the Whistler Gondola 2001 Team Diva has competed in the Battle of the Ski Schools, World Synchronized Skiing Championships 4 times with one First place finish and 3 second place results in the Women's division.
So what is synchronized skiing? Eight people ski down a slope in (obviously) synchronized formations. The patterns change during the descent to make for some very interesting designs. It requires great focus and concentration to know your part and who appears close to you as we sometimes pass each other by mere inches. It's a terrific amount of fun and I especially love to watch the other team's choreography. The 2001 Competition was held in Whistler, British Columbia, Canada for the first time. Previously, it had always been in Vail, Colorado, USA.
My participation I have proudly been on the team for three years now, since 1999. The first year, I made the team as an alternate. The team consists of 9 skiers with one person sitting out each pass to make 8 skiers in a figure. In 2000, I was a key member of the team and was ready to compete in both the regional Championships held that spring in Aspen and the Worlds' held in Vail. Unfortunately, I broke my leg in team training just weeks before competing. After a long recovery period and missing an entire South American season, I nervously tried out for the team again in 2001. I made the team and ended up skiing in every figure, even as second lead in two figures. It was an incredible experience for me to come back so strong after my injury and I am so grateful to my coaches and team members for their support. On top of Whistler and feeling on top of the world
